RED CABBAGE SLAW



Red Cabbage Slaw image

Provided by Anne Burrell

Time 1h20m

Yield 12 cups

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 small head red cabbage, tough bottom ribs removed, shredded (about 6 cups)
2 bulbs fennel, cored and julienned
3 carrots, grated
2 Granny Smith apples, julienned
1 red onion, very thinly sliced
1 cup apple cider vinegar
Kosher salt
1 1/2 to 2 cups mayonnaise
2 to 3 tablespoons horseradish

Steps:

  • Combine the cabbage, fennel, carrots, apples and onion in a large bowl. Douse with the vinegar, season with salt and let sit at least 1 hour. This will soften the cabbage and make it seem almost cooked, but it will still have a great texture.
  • Drain the cabbage of excess liquid but still keep it fairly juicy. Stir in the mayonnaise and horseradish. Taste for seasoning and add salt. The result should be a creamy and tart slaw.

CABBAGE AND FENNEL SLAW



Cabbage and Fennel Slaw image

This simple slaw is great for picnics or backyard barbecues. Fennel updates the classic recipe by adding a sweet licorice flavor.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Salad Recipes

Time 45m

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/4 small head red cabbage (about 1 pound), shredded
1 large fennel bulb, trimmed, halved, and sliced very thin
2 large carrots, shredded
1/4 cup thinly sliced scallion greens (from 2 scallions)
1 teaspoon minced peeled fresh ginger
1/4 cup fresh orange juice
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
2 tablespoons cider vinegar
Coarse salt and ground pepper

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, toss together cabbage, fennel, carrots, and scallion greens. In a small bowl, whisk together ginger, orange juice, oil, and vinegar; season with salt and pepper. Pour dressing over vegetables and toss to coat completely. Refrigerate at least 30 minutes (or up to 1 1/2 hours). Toss slaw before serving.

SMOKY PORK BURGERS WITH FENNEL AND RED CABBAGE SLAW



Smoky Pork Burgers With Fennel and Red Cabbage Slaw image

Jennifer Hess, a food blogger from Providence, R.I., was an early Food52 member. Her smoky pork burger with fennel and red cabbage slaw won the "Your Best Grilled Pork Recipe" contest.

Provided by Kim Severson

Categories     dinner, quick, main course

Time 30m

Yield 4 burgers

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 tablespoons fennel seed
1/2 cup finely diced onion
3 small garlic cloves, minced
1/2 teaspoon kosher or sea salt
2 teaspoons smoked Spanish paprika
1 pound ground pork, preferably sirloin
1 cup minced bacon, (about 3 thick strips, slightly frozen before chopping)
4 soft burger rolls or sandwich buns
2 tablespoons sherry vinegar
1 teaspoon apple cider vinegar
1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
1/2 teaspoon kosher or sea salt
1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il
1 cup shredded fennel bulb, plus chopped fronds
1 1/2 cup shredded red cabbage

Steps:

  • To cook burgers: Prepare a grill.
  • Gently toast fennel seeds in a dry skillet until aromatic.
  • In a large bowl, combine fennel seeds, onion, garlic, salt and smoked paprika.
  • Add pork and bacon. Toss gently until well mixed, without overworking meat.
  • Divide into four portions and shape into patties. Place on a plate or platter and chill for at least one hour.
  • Cook burgers for about 6 minutes on hot side of grill. After 3 minutes, flip and cook 3 more minutes, then move to cool part of grill for 3 more minutes. Burgers can also be fried in a pan over medium-high heat for about 3 minutes on each side. Let burgers rest for a few minutes, tented with foil, before serving.
  • To prepare slaw: Whisk vinegars, mustard and salt in a bowl until salt is dissolved. Add oil and whisk until emulsified.
  • Place fennel bulb and cabbage into bowl and toss to combine with dressing. Add fennel fronds and toss again just before serving.
  • Place burgers on toasted or lightly grilled buns and top each with a little slaw.

CABBAGE, FRESH FENNEL, AND CARROT SLAW



Cabbage, Fresh Fennel, and Carrot Slaw image

Categories     Salad     Onion     Side     No-Cook     Vegetarian     Mayonnaise     Fennel     Carrot     Summer     Cabbage     Sour Cream     Bon Appétit     Pescatarian     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Makes 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 2 1/2-pound cabbage, quartered, cored, very thinly sliced (about 18 cups)
2 fresh fennel bulbs, trimmed, halved, very thinly sliced (about 3 cups)
1 small onion, thinly sliced
1 very large carrot, peeled, coarsely shredded
3/4 cup mayonnaise
1/2 cup sour cream
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1/2 teaspoon sugar
1/2 teaspoon hot pepper sauce

Steps:

  • Combine cabbage, fennel, onion, and carrot in large bowl. Whisk mayonnaise, sour cream, lemon juice, sugar, and hot sauce in medium bowl to blend. Season dressing to taste with salt and pepper. Add dressing to cabbage mixture; toss to coat. Season slaw to taste with salt and pepper. Refrigerate at least 1 hour and up to 2 hours, tossing occasionally. Transfer to serving bowl.
